The foreleg of the horse is, for the most part, a model of good engineering. Most of a horse’s weight is carried on its forelimbs. A horse puts more stress on its front legs than its rear limbs, because it carries 60-65 percent of its weight up front.
While good conformation will help ensure long-term soundness, no horse has perfect conformation. Therefore, it is necessary to rely on experts to determine which conformation is best suited to a particular discipline or use.
This third installment of the anatomy and physiology series takes an in-depth look at just how the equine forelimb is constructed, what constitutes good conformation, and what can go awry when poor conformation is involved.
